How does changing your Outlook password truly work? The process is straightforward when guided by best practices. Start by logging into your Outlook account via a trusted device. Use a long, unique phrase or combination of let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id reuse across accounts—this is a cornerstone of modern password safety. Most email platforms now support password reset via security questions, two-factor verification, or temporary link emails. The key is consistency: update passwords every 6 to 12 months, especially if accounts are accessed on shared devices or public systems.
Many users ask: When exactly should I change my Outlook password? Experts recommend updating immediately after suspected breaches, after prolonged inactivity, or whenever you notice unusual login alerts. It’s also wise to refresh passwords after using public Wi-Fi networks or when switching from company to personal use. For those managing multiple accounts, consider using a trusted password manager to generate and store secure credentials—making regular changes both easier and safer.

Yet misunderstandings persist. One common myth: “A strong password never needs changing.” In reality, even robust passwords should be refreshed periodically due to evolving digital threats and compromised databases. Another concern is, “Will changing my password disrupt my workflow?” When done through official channels, the impact is minimal—most platforms allow quick resets with minimal friction, often within minutes.
